Basement Stabilization in Columbus, OH
Basement stabilization services focus on reinforcing and supporting the foundation of a home to prevent or address issues caused by shifting, settling, or structural damage. These services are commonly requested for projects involving uneven floors, cracked walls, or noticeable bowing in basement walls. Property owners typically seek information about the methods used to stabilize their basements, the signs indicating a need for stabilization, and the potential impact on their property’s safety and value.
Before requesting basement stabilization, homeowners should understand the extent of the foundation movement and any underlying causes, such as soil conditions or water issues. It is also helpful to know what types of stabilization techniques are available, including underpinning, wall braces, or pier systems, and how they can be tailored to different basement structures. Clear communication about the scope of work and expected outcomes can assist property owners in making informed decisions about maintaining a safe and stable basement environment.

Common Basement Stabilization Jobs
Basement wall stabilization involves reinforcing or repairing walls to prevent shifting and cracking.
Soil stabilization helps improve ground support around the foundation to reduce settling.
Pier and beam stabilization addresses uneven floors caused by shifting or sinking supports.
Foundation underpinning strengthens weakened basement structures to restore stability.
Crack injection and sealing prevent water intrusion and further damage in basement walls.
Drainage correction improves water flow around the foundation to minimize moisture-related issues.
Basement Stabilization Questions
What causes basement instability issues? Common causes include soil settlement, poor drainage, and foundation movement that lead to uneven pressure on basement walls.
How can basement stabilization improve a property? It helps prevent further damage, reduces the risk of structural failure, and can stabilize basement walls for safety and longevity.
What types of stabilization methods are used? Techniques often involve wall reinforcement, underpinning, or installing support systems to strengthen the foundation.
Is basement stabilization necessary for all foundation problems? Not all issues require stabilization; a professional assessment can determine if reinforcement is needed for safety and stability.
